Best Practices in Mechanical System Optimization

EDPs in Designing and Optimizing Mechanical Systems for Energy Efficiency emphasize the importance of adopting best practices that ensure the successful implementation of energy-efficient solutions. Some of these best practices include:

1. Conducting Thorough System Analysis: A comprehensive analysis of existing systems is crucial for identifying areas of inefficiency and opportunities for improvement.

2. Adopting a Holistic Design Approach: A holistic design approach that considers the entire system, including mechanical, electrical, and control components, is essential for achieving optimal performance.

3. Leveraging Emerging Technologies: The integration of emerging technologies, such as artificial intelligence, IoT, and advanced materials, can significantly enhance the efficiency and performance of mechanical systems.

4. Fostering a Culture of Continuous Improvement: Encouraging a culture of continuous improvement, where employees are empowered to identify and implement energy-efficient solutions, is critical for sustaining long-term success.
